In-pipe UV wastewater treatment for non-potable reuse
Treating Filtered Effluent
Depending on site constraints and treatment plant design requirements, facilities producing filtered effluent may favour an in-pipe (closed-vessel) UV disinfection solution. The TrojanUVFit® provides a compact, energy-efficient, and highly effective option for non-potable water reuse applications. Its hydraulically optimised design minimises head loss and integrates seamlessly into the treatment process without disrupting system hydraulics. Available in multiple configurations, the system can accommodate a broad range of flow rates, with capacities of up to 7 MGD per chamber.

Key Features and Benefits
Compact Design and Installation Flexibility
The compact chamber footprint is well suited for indoor retrofit applications and offers flexible installation options, including parallel or series configurations, to accommodate system redundancy and future capacity expansion. All UV lamps and quartz sleeves are fully accessible through the chamber end cap, enabling convenient maintenance while allowing installation adjacent to walls, piping, or other equipment.


Robust Sleeve Cleaning System
The sleeve cleaning system is designed to minimise fouling on quartz sleeves, helping to maintain maximum UV transmittance and consistent treatment performance. Operating automatically at predetermined intervals, the system requires no operator intervention and performs cleaning without interrupting the disinfection process.
Reliable Performance and Easy Maintenance
UV lamps, quartz sleeves, lamp drivers, sensors, and the sleeve cleaning system are built on proven technologies with a strong track record across hundreds of installations worldwide. All internal components are readily accessible through the chamber end cap, which automatically deactivates the UV lamps when opened to enhance operator safety. Routine maintenance activities, including lamp replacement, can be completed quickly and efficiently, minimising downtime and maintenance effort.


3rd Party Validation
The TrojanUVFit® has undergone comprehensive microbial validation testing to verify its disinfection performance. This testing generated performance data confirming the system's ability to deliver the required UV dose for the effective inactivation of microorganisms, including Poliovirus, Escherichia coli (E. coli), and fecal coliform bacteria.
For water reuse applications in California, several TrojanUVFit® models have been approved by the California Department of Public Health for compliance with Title 22 water reuse requirements.
